Clyde Bellecourt
Born May 8, 1936Died January 11, 2022 (85 years)
Clyde Howard Bellecourt (1936-2022) was a Native American civil rights organizer. He founded the American Indian Movement (AIM) in Minneapolis, Minnesota, in 1968 with Dennis Banks, Eddie Benton-Banai, and George Mitchell. His elder brother, Vernon Bellecourt, was also active in the movement.
